In the Indonesia gas compressors market, the import trend experienced a decline from 2023 to 2024, with a growth rate of -4.65%. However,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for imports over the period 2020-2024 stood at a robust 28.21%. This shift in import momentum could be attributed to changing demand dynamics or fluctuations in trade policies impacting market stability.

The Indonesia gas compressors market is experiencing growth driven by the expanding oil and gas industry in the region. With the government focusing on increasing domestic production and supporting infrastructure development, the demand for gas compressors for various applications such as gas processing, transmission, and storage is on the rise. Key players in the market are investing in technological advancements to enhance compressor efficiency and reliability, catering to the evolving needs of the industry. The market is witnessing a trend towards the adoption of environmentally friendly and energy-efficient compressors to meet sustainability goals. Additionally, the increasing focus on offshore exploration activities in Indonesia is expected to further drive the demand for gas compressors in the coming years.
